In Ruby, you can sort characters in a string using the chars
method to convert the string into an array of characters, then sorting the array, and joining it back into a string.
In this example,
str
.chars
method.str = 'hello world'
sorted_str = str.chars.sort.join
puts 'Sorted string in ascending order: ' + sorted_str
Sorted string in ascending order: dehllloorw
In this example,
str
.chars
method.str = 'hello world'
sorted_str = str.chars.sort.reverse.join
puts 'Sorted string in descending order: ' + sorted_str
Sorted string in descending order: wroolllhed
In this tutorial, we learned How to Sort Characters in String in Ruby language with well detailed examples.